Assessing the Viability of Bitcoin and Cryptocurrency in Ultra-Luxury Closings
Crypto can be part of an ultra-luxury purchase, but it is rarely a literal “wallet-to-seller” closing. In South Florida, the most viable path is treating digital assets as a source of funds that are converted to U.S. dollars well before closing, with disciplined documentation, tax planning, and bankability. The real question for buyers and sellers is not whether crypto is real wealth, but whether it can clear compliance, timing, and title requirements without introducing avoidable volatility or reputational risk.
